  • Veterans Advisory Committee: 1 vacancy: 1 alternate (5 members to be veterans, can include family members of veterans)
    • Advisory matters would include promoting veterans rights, arranging for appropriate ceremonies honoring veterans on holidays or otherwise, helping unify veterans groups, keeping the Town Council informed of problems and/or issues affecting veterans and supporting the needs of veterans. The term is one year ending December 31 of each calendar year, subject to reappointment and continuing to serve until a successor is appointed.
